Abstract

A method for manufacturing a structural surface heat exchanger of preset or left-hand final shape for an aircraft includes the steps of forming, shaping and assembling, by welding or brazing, a first corrugated skin and a second smooth skin in order to obtain channels. Each channel is delimited by a corrugation of the first skin and the second smooth skin so as to form a structural surface heat exchanger of preset or left-hand final shape, wherein a fluid is configured to circulate in the channels and air is configured to circulate in contact with the second smooth skin.
